Underfloor heating case study

Products: TileFix-18® overfloor system, Quantum RF thermostats

We were contacted by an installer who needed to fit underfloor heating (UFH) in a 78m2 single-storey lodge in Lancashire. This striking timber-framed property has vaulted ceilings, floor-to-ceiling glass panels and an open-plan kitchen, dining and living area, creating a large area that required UFH.

The initial enquiry came to Continal quite a long time after the building work had started. The concrete slab had been laid, and construction of the building’s timber frame was also complete. This meant our customer needed a non-screed system that could be fitted on top of the existing floor. The customer had also already laid the floor insulation, which was something that whatever UFH system we recommended would need to work around.

We also had to take the homeowner’s desired floor finish – slate tiles – into consideration, as any UFH system would need to be suitable for use with a tiled floor.

Continal Technical Sales Adviser Carol Jordan arranged for a video call with both the homeowner and the installer to discuss all the details of the project and make sure she understood the building’s unique requirements. Then, she recommended that Continal’s TileFix-18® overfloor system be installed on top of the insulation and concrete slab, with the pipe being laid at 100mm centres in the open-plan area, and at 150mm centres everywhere else.

TileFix-18® is a fast-response, high compressive strength system that is ideal for both renovation and newbuild projects. Unlike many UFH systems, TileFix-18® is suitable for use with tiled floors using a standard tile adhesive, and is typically installed over existing floors.

This low-profile system offers flexibility with pipe spacings available in 100mm, 150mm and 200mm centres, and the universal TileFix® panels provide pipe routing for return loops and distribution, ensuring simple installation.

The homeowner also wanted the UFH system to be fitted with app-controlled thermostats so that he could adjust the heating remotely, so we recommended our Quantum RF digital thermostats and a Quantum hub, which offer stylish features and can be operated either remotely or manually, depending on the user’s preference.
